Work begins on East Canal Road widening

OBA Staff • September 9, 2022

Three lanes coming to a portion of East Canal Road

Canal Road East Widening project has begun

Orange Beach, Ala. - (OBA) - Work has commenced on the East Canal Road widening RESTORE grant project from Highway 161 to Wilson Boulevard. 


This roughly 1.4-mile section of Canal Road will be expanded to three lanes to allow for a middle turn lane. A roundabout will be constructed near the public library and a 10-foot multi-use path will be created on the north side of the road between Callaway Drive and Wilson Boulevard. 


Thompson Engineering is the project engineer and John G. Walton Construction Company, Inc. was awarded the construction contract in the amount of $7.36 million. The majority of the cost for this project will be paid for with post-BP oil spill Resources and Ecosystem Sustainability, Tourism Opportunities, and Revived Economies of the Gulf Coast States Act of 2012 (RESTORE Act) funds. The RESTORE grant will cover $5.9 million.

A Work of Art of Orange Beach winner of the 2026 Blue Marlin Grand Championship
By OBA Staff July 24, 2026
Orange Beach, Ala. — (OBA) — A Work of Art of Orange Beach won the 2026 Blue Marlin Grand Championship at The Wharf. The team became the first three-time winner in tournament history and caught the event’s heaviest blue marlin. The victory came during a tournament that set records for both fleet size and prize money.
